A Historical Perspective

The concept of AI dates back to ancient myths and folklore, where mechanical beings exhibited human-like intelligence. However, the modern roots of AI can be traced to the mid-20th century when pioneers like Alan Turing and John McCarthy laid the foundations for computer-based intelligence. Turing's Turing Test and McCarthy's Dartmouth Workshop marked significant milestones in the development of AI as a field of study.

Key AI Technologies

AI encompasses a variety of technologies, each contributing to different facets of its capabilities:

Machine Learning (ML): ML is a subset of AI that focuses on enabling computers to learn from data and improve their performance over time. It includes techniques like supervised learning, unsupervised learning, and reinforcement learning.

Deep Learning: Deep learning is a subset of ML that involves neural networks with multiple layers, emulating the human brain's complex structure. This technology has led to breakthroughs in image recognition, natural language processing, and more.

Natural Language Processing (NLP): NLP enables computers to understand, interpret, and generate human language. From chatbots to language translation, NLP has transformed how we interact with technology.

Computer Vision: Computer vision enables machines to interpret and understand visual information from the world, enabling applications like facial recognition, object detection, and autonomous vehicles.

Robotics: AI-powered robots are becoming increasingly sophisticated, with applications ranging from manufacturing and healthcare to exploration and disaster response.

Applications of AI

AI's impact spans across industries:

Healthcare: AI aids in medical image analysis, drug discovery, personalized treatment plans, and even robot-assisted surgeries.

Finance: AI powers algorithmic trading, fraud detection, credit scoring, and financial planning.

Retail: AI-driven recommendation systems personalize shopping experiences, optimize supply chains, and enable cashier-less stores.

Transportation: Self-driving cars and predictive maintenance are revolutionizing the automotive industry.

Education: AI-driven tutoring systems offer personalized learning experiences, adapting to individual student needs.

Entertainment: Content recommendation algorithms on streaming platforms and AI-generated art are changing how we consume media.

Challenges and Considerations

While AI offers immense potential, it also presents challenges:

Bias and Fairness: AI systems can inherit biases present in training data, leading to discriminatory outcomes. Ensuring fairness and inclusivity is a critical concern.

Ethics: The development of autonomous weapons and the potential for job displacement raise ethical dilemmas that require careful consideration.

Transparency: Complex AI models like deep neural networks can be challenging to interpret, leading to concerns about accountability and decision-making.

Data Privacy: AI's success relies on vast amounts of data, but handling this data responsibly and respecting privacy rights is a growing concern.
